What exactly is our CDN?

Our content distribution network is described in detail.

Our CDN is a worldwide network of physical, optimised servers that cache the content of your website served by our platform. Customers from all over the world will connect to those CDN nodes rather than our local network, resulting in faster content delivery and faster loading of your websites.

Dynamic Cache

Using public Cache-Control and Expires headers, our dynamic cache can cache any resource at our edge. Once enabled, you can begin storing content in this cache by configuring your application to emit those headers. Any responses containing a cookie will not be cached. When combined with StackCache, this provides full-page dynamic content caching, ensuring rapid TTFB times for all resources regardless of visitor location. Advanced users can determine whether a resource was cached by inspecting the X-CDN-Cache-Status header.

Security Headers

Control how your CDN is accessed by managing security headers. X-Frame-Options, X-Content-Type-Options, Referrer-Policy, Strict-Transport-Security, X-XSS-Protection, and Content-Security-Policy are examples of these.

X-Frame-Options – Used to indicate whether or not a browser should be allowed to render a page in a <frame>, <iframe>, <embed> or <object>.

X-Content-Type-Options – Is used by the server to indicate that the MIME types advertised in the Content-Type headers should not be changed and be followed.

Referrer-Policy – This controls how much referrer information (sent via the Referer header) should be included with requests.

Strict-Transport-Security – This response header lets a web site tell browsers that it should only be accessed using HTTPS, instead of using HTTP.

X-XSS-Protection – This response header is a feature of Internet Explorer, Chrome and Safari that stops pages from loading when they detect re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ks.

Content-Security-Policy – This response header allows web site administrators to control resources the user agent is allowed to load for a given page.

    Block Visitors

    Prevent unwanted visitors.

    You can block IP addresses, entire subnets, or even entire countries with our CDN. Select a country from a drop-down menu to automatically block all IP addresses from that country (relies on GeoIP IP address data).

    With wildcards and CIDRs, you can block IP addresses. Both 192.168.0.0/24 and 192.168.0.*, for example, would block all IP addresses between 192.168.0.0 and 192.168.0.255.
